The cheapest way to get from Alessandria to Cremona is to train via Pavia which costs €8 - €15 and takes 4h 25m.
The fastest way to get from Alessandria to Cremona is to drive which takes 1h 24m and costs €19 - €29.
No, there is no direct train from Alessandria to Cremona. However, there are services departing from Alessandria and arriving at Cremona via Milan Rogoredo.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 54m.
The distance between Alessandria and Cremona is 170 km. The road distance is 130.1 km.
The best way to get from Alessandria to Cremona without a car is to train which takes 2h 54m and costs €11 - €15.
It takes approximately 2h 54m to get from Alessandria to Cremona, including transfers.
